Overview
The incumbent is responsible for the provision of graphics and reproduction services in support of briefings, conferences, exercises, correspondence and documents.
Key Responsibilities
- Implements photographic, graphics arts program and operates the printing and reproduction services.
- Designs, co-ordinates and elaborates forms and publication and provides reprographics support to the Command and collocated Commands.
- Controls, manages, and stores graphics files made by the Cell.
- Combines expertise and creativity to develop pictures and decorations in the production of graphics arts.
- Supports personnel on daily activities related to the graphic creation and software-graphics equipment.
- Maintains contact with local companies and suppliers of printing materials. Assesses new products and makes recommendations for purchase of new items, materials, equipment, for which knowledge of the host nation language is needed.
